nano-pdf

Use nano-pdf to apply edits to a specific page in a PDF using a natural-language instruction.

Quick start

nano-pdf edit deck.pdf 1 "Change the title to 'Q3 Results' and fix the typo in the subtitle"

Notes:

  • Page numbers are 0-based or 1-based depending on the tool’s version/config; if the result looks off by one, retry with the other.
  • Always sanity-check the output PDF before sending it out.
